Alejandro Ivan Osornio
March 16, 2010 - March 16, 2010
Alejandro Ivan Castro Osornio, infant son of Lillian Castro and Ivan Osornio was born and died Tuesday March 16, 2010 in Ardmore, Oklahoma. Survived by his parents, Lillian & Ivan Osornio, Sulphur; sister, Isabella Osornio, brother,... View Obituary & Service Information
